War on drugs continues, says Duterte

President Rodrigo Duterte has no plans to cease the government’s war on drugs even with the International Criminal Court’s (ICC) impending preliminary investigation against him.

“The war or the drive against drugs will not stop and it will last until the day I step out,” Duterte said in a speech at the Vicente Sotto Memorial Medical Center in Cebu City.

He added that if continuing the campaign against illegal drugs could bring him to prison, then so be it.

“If I go to prison, I will go to prison,” Duterte said.

He also said he is ready to stand by his belief and is ready to die for it.

“If you want to execute me, look for a country that allows the execution of prisoner by firing squad,” he said.

Duterte is set to undergo a preliminary investigation after Filipino lawyer Jude Sabio filed charges against him before the ICC.

The initial probe will focus on the alleged misconducts committed by Duterte in his campaign to end the proliferation of narcotics in the country.
